Jane Higginbottom

Twist, 2009

A private commission to use a branch of a old (200 year?) cherry tree from clients garden, which had to be chopped down due to old age and rot. The sculpture emerged from the shapes inherent in the branch, after removing some rotten areas. It is a new life for the wood and has a flame like feel - the phoenix.

63cm x 20cm x 20cm

Cherry wood - Purbeck marble base
